UNSC condemns Rwanda, M23 rebels for offensive in eastern DR Congo

Dec 21, 2025

Washington [US], December 21: The United Nations Security Council (UNSC) has condemned Rwanda for backing a rebel offensive in eastern Democratic Republic of the Congo and urged it to withdraw its forces and stop supporting the M23 armed group.
The UNSC unanimously adopted the resolution on Friday, and also extended the UN peacekeeping mission in the DRC, known as MONUSCO, for a year. This came despite Rwanda's repeated denials - contrary to overwhelming evidence - of involvement in a conflict that has intensified as a United States-brokered peace deal unravels. The UNSC said M23's seizure of the strategic city of Uvira "risks destabilizing the whole region, gravely endangers civilian populations and imperils ongoing peace efforts". "M23 must immediately withdraw at least 75km (47 miles) from Uvira and return to compliance with all of its obligations undertaken in the Framework Agreement," said Jennifer Locetta, a US representative to the UN.
